What is an Electric Window Cleaner? Why Do You Need It?
An electric window cleaner is a modern device designed to simplify the chore of cleaning glass surfaces. Unlike traditional methods that rely on buckets, sponges, and squeegees, these tools use electrical power for automated or power-assisted cleaning. They typically feature strong suction, automated spray systems, and microfiber pads to ensure streak-free results.
The main advantage of using an electric window cleaner is the significant reduction in time and effort required. Tasks that once took hours can now be completed in a fraction of the time, often with minimal user input. These cleaners are engineered to provide consistent, even cleaning, eliminating common issues like streaks and drips. For homes with many or hard-to-reach windows, such as high-rise apartments or expansive glass walls, an electric window cleaner also improves safety by reducing the need for ladders and precarious stretching. It is an essential tool for anyone seeking efficiency, convenience, and professional-level cleanliness without the professional cost.
Popular Types of Electric Window Cleaners on the Market
The market offers various electric window cleaners, each suited for different needs and window types. Understanding these options is crucial for making an informed decision.
Electric Handheld Window Vacuums
Electric handheld window vacuums are compact, portable devices that efficiently manage condensation and clean smaller glass surfaces. They typically combine a rubber blade with powerful suction to remove dirty water and cleaning solution, preventing drips and ensuring a streak-free finish.
- Advantages: These devices are small, lightweight, and very easy to maneuver, making them ideal for quick clean-ups and intricate window panes. Many are cordless and rechargeable, offering excellent flexibility. They are highly effective for condensation, shower screens, mirrors, and car windows.
- Disadvantages: While efficient for smaller tasks, they still require manual guidance. Their reach is limited, often requiring extension poles for higher windows, which may not always be practical.
- Ideal for: Homeowners with numerous small to medium-sized windows, shower enclosures, glass tables, or those needing a quick solution for condensation and everyday smudges.
Robot Window Cleaners
Robot window cleaners offer hands-free window maintenance, using advanced technology to clean glass surfaces automatically. These smart devices adhere to windows via strong suction or magnetic force and navigate across the pane following intelligent cleaning paths.
- Advantages: The primary benefit of robot window cleaners is their fully automated operation, saving considerable time and effort. They are perfect for large, tall, or hard-to-reach windows, including floor-to-ceiling glass and high-rise apartment windows, where safety is a major concern. Many models feature smart navigation (AI path planning), edge detection, multi-directional spray systems, and can be controlled via an app or remote. Integrated safety features like anti-fall systems and UPS backup batteries provide peace of mind.
- Disadvantages: Robot window cleaners generally have a higher price point than handheld vacuums. They might require some initial setup, and their performance can sometimes be affected by irregular window shapes or very dirty surfaces, potentially requiring a pre-clean.
- Ideal for: Individuals with large homes, numerous windows, high-rise apartments, or anyone prioritizing automation and safety for demanding window cleaning tasks.
While magnetic window cleaners also clean both sides of the glass, they are typically manual or semi-manual and require a specific glass thickness, often falling outside the “electric” category of automation or power-assisted suction. Similarly, specialized liquid glass cleaners are essential companions but require an accompanying tool, electric or otherwise, to maximize their cleaning potential.
Comparison Table of Electric Window Cleaner Types
Choosing between an electric handheld vacuum and a robot window cleaner depends on your specific needs and priorities. Here’s a detailed comparison:
| Feature | Electric Handheld Window Vacuums | Robot Window Cleaners |
|---|---|---|
| Price Range | Low to Mid | Mid to High |
| Effort Required | Moderate (manual guidance) | Minimal (mostly automated) |
| Ideal Window Size | Small to Medium | Large, Tall, Numerous |
| Reach | Limited (requires extension for high windows) | Excellent (climbs windows independently) |
| Cleaning Speed | Fast for small areas, depends on user speed | Varies by model and window size; systematic |
| Key Features | Suction, streak-free finish, cordless, lightweight | Automated navigation, spray nozzles, app/remote control, safety systems, edge detection |
| Versatility | Windows, mirrors, tiles, shower screens, condensation | Windows, glass doors, some models on tiles/smooth walls |
| Portability | Highly portable, easy to store | Less portable, requires setup, can be bulky (with station) |
| Safety | Low risk (ground-level cleaning) | High safety for elevated windows (reduces ladder use) |
Guide to Choosing the Right Electric Window Cleaner
Selecting the perfect electric window cleaner involves a thoughtful assessment of your specific needs, the type of windows you have, and your budget. Consider these crucial factors before making your purchase:
-
Identify Your Needs:
- Window Type and Size: Do you have small, easily accessible windows, or large, floor-to-ceiling panes? Are they framed or frameless? Robot cleaners excel on large, tall, or numerous windows, while handheld vacuums are perfect for smaller, indoor glass.
- Cleaning Frequency: If you clean frequently or suffer from persistent condensation, a handheld electric window vacuum might be a daily go-to. For less frequent, large-scale cleans, a robot is a significant investment.
- Budget: Electric handheld vacuums are generally more affordable, while advanced robot models represent a more substantial investment. Determine how much you’re willing to spend for convenience and automation.
-
Important Criteria When Choosing:
- Suction Power (for robot/handheld vacs): Measured in Pascals (Pa) for robots, higher suction ensures a firm grip on the glass and more effective removal of dirty water for handhelds. For robots, robust suction is crucial for safety and stability.
- Battery Life: Cordless models rely on battery power. Consider the run time per charge – especially for robot cleaners that tackle large areas – and the charging time. Some robots offer “plugged-in” modes for continuous cleaning on massive surfaces.
- Cleaning Modes and Features: Robot cleaners often come with multiple cleaning paths (N-path, Z-path, automatic, deep clean, spot clean). Look for features like automatic water spray, intelligent navigation (AI path planning), and edge detection for frameless windows.
- Ease of Use and Control: Do you prefer simple button operation or advanced control via a smartphone app? Remote controls offer convenience, while app control can provide scheduling and monitoring capabilities.
- Safety Features: For robot cleaners, an anti-fall system, a safety rope, and a built-in Uninterruptible Power Supply (UPS) that provides backup power during outages are essential for preventing accidents.
- Water Tank Capacity: A larger dirty water tank on handheld vacuums means fewer interruptions for emptying. For robot cleaners, consider the cleaning solution tank size.
- Brand Reputation and Warranty: Choose reputable brands known for durability and good customer support. A strong warranty can offer peace of mind for your investment.
When purchasing, whether online or in-store, always check product specifications thoroughly and read user reviews. Real-world feedback can offer invaluable insights into a device’s performance and potential quirks.

How to Use and Maintain Your Electric Window Cleaner Correctly
Proper usage and maintenance are key to maximizing the lifespan and performance of your electric window cleaner, ensuring streak-free results every time.
Using Your Electric Window Cleaner
- Preparation: Always start by ensuring your device is fully charged. For handheld window vacuums, fill the integrated spray bottle with clean water and a suitable window cleaning solution. For robot cleaners with a water tank, fill it according to the manufacturer’s instructions.
- Pre-Clean (Optional but Recommended): For very dirty windows with accumulated grime, a quick manual wipe-down or spray with a hose can prevent excessive strain on the cleaner and improve final results.
- Operation for Handheld Window Vacuums:
- Spray the window surface thoroughly with cleaning solution.
- Use a microfiber cloth or the device’s integrated pad to gently agitate the dirt.
- Turn on the window vac and glide the rubber blade downwards from top to bottom, overlapping slightly with each pass. The vacuum will suck up the dirty water, leaving a dry, streak-free surface.
- Operation for Robot Window Cleaners:
- Ensure the cleaning pads are attached and the water tank is filled.
- Place the robot firmly on the window surface. It will typically use suction to attach itself.
- Activate the robot via its power button, remote control, or smartphone app.
- Allow the robot to complete its cleaning cycle. Many models will return to their starting point when finished.
- Once done, turn off the robot, carefully detach it from the window, and remove the cleaning pads.
Frequently Asked Questions
What are the main types of electric window cleaners available?
There are two main types of electric window cleaners: electric handheld window vacuums and robot window cleaners. Handheld vacuums are compact and manually guided, ideal for smaller surfaces, while robot cleaners are automated, perfect for large or hard-to-reach windows.
How do electric window cleaners prevent streaks on glass?
Electric window cleaners prevent streaks by using powerful suction to remove dirty water and cleaning solution immediately after application. This process ensures that no residue is left behind to dry and cause streaks, providing a consistently clean finish.
Are robot window cleaners safe for high-rise apartment windows?
Yes, robot window cleaners are generally safe for high-rise apartment windows due to features like strong suction, anti-fall systems, safety ropes, and built-in UPS backup batteries. These safety mechanisms prevent the robot from falling, reducing the need for ladders.
What factors should I consider when choosing an electric window cleaner?
When choosing an electric window cleaner, consider your window type and size, cleaning frequency, and budget. Important criteria include suction power, battery life, cleaning modes, ease of use, safety features, water tank capacity, and brand reputation.
How often should I clean my electric window cleaner for optimal performance?
You should clean the rubber blades and dirty water tank of your electric handheld window vacuum after each use. For robot window cleaners, clean the microfiber pads and empty the water tank after every cleaning cycle to maintain optimal performance and prevent residue buildup.
